
Hardback
Published 13 Oct 1996
- $54.46
5 results
Hardback
Published 13 Oct 1996
Paperback
Published 10 Feb 2005
Paperback
Published 15 Apr 2011
Paperback
Paperback
Published 01 Jan 1970